Year: 1948
Runtime: 125 mins
Language: English
Director: George Sidney
THE COMPLETE ROMANCE…THE FULL NOVEL! Athletic adaptation of Alexandre Dumas’ classic adventure about the king’s musketeers and their mission to protect France.

In a glittering yet turbulent 17th‑century France, the king’s Musketeers stand as the living embodiment of honor, daring, and loyalty. Their sword‑play echoes through the cobbled streets of Paris, while the court shimmers with intrigue and romance. The film captures this world with a lush, athletic flourish, blending swash‑buckling adventure and sweeping sentiment to evoke the timeless charm of Dumas’s classic.
D’Artagnan arrives from the rugged provinces, a youthful Gascon whose heart beats with the promise of glory. He carries a burning ambition to earn a place among the elite defenders of the realm, and his wide‑eyed optimism clashes with the harsh realities of city life. As he steps onto the bustling avenues of Paris, the atmosphere crackles with both danger and opportunity, setting the stage for a journey that will test his courage and spirit.
Within the ranks, three seasoned warriors define the musketeer myth. Athos exudes a dignified, measured gravitas, hinting at hidden depths beneath his stoic exterior. Porthos radiates flamboyant strength and a love for life’s pleasures, his larger‑than‑life presence both comforting and inspiring. Aramis combines scholarly wit with a quiet, razor‑sharp skill, suggesting a mind always plotting the next move. Their commander, de Treville, watches the young aspirant with a discerning eye, aware that the future of the kingdom may rest on the shoulders of those willing to step forward.
The tone of the story balances romance with razor‑edge tension, inviting viewers into a world where loyalty is a blade sharpened by friendship, and every duel holds the promise of destiny. With a soundtrack that swells like a marching regiment and visuals as vivid as a courtly tapestry, the film immerses the audience in an era where honor guides the sword and the heart yearns for adventure. The stage is set, the characters poised, and the promise of an unforgettable saga looms on the horizon.
